New lead back for NOLA
Etienne has agreed to terms Monday on a contract with the Saints, Adam Schefter of ESPN reports.
ANALYSIS
Etienne becomes the clear No. 1 option in a New Orleans backfield that also houses incumbents Alvin Kamara (knee), Kendre Miller (ACL), Devin Neal (hamstring) and Audric Estime. The Louisiana native surpassed 1,000 rushing yards in three of the last four seasons as the leader of Jacksonville's rushing attack, and his combination of speed and three-down skills project as an ideal fit for Saints head coach Kellen Moore's offensive scheme. Ian Rapoport of NFL Network reports that Etienne's contract is a four-year, $52 million deal, a commitment that signals he likely will be utilized in a similar workhorse role to the one he attained down the stretch of his tenure with the Jaguars.

Etienne's 2024 season was a disaster, making him one of the biggest fantasy busts of the year. There might not be much to make of the season, though. The Jaguars' collapse under the stale direction of Doug Pederson and Press Taylor was memorable and rare – it isn't often that you see a team unable to execute basic operations like the Jaguars under Pederson in 2024. Schematically, there probably won't be much in common between the 2024 offense under Taylor and the 2025 version under Liam Coen. The burst of Bucky Irving became a primary theme in Coen's Tampa Bay offense, and while fellow Jaguars runner Tank Bigsby can provide power functions, it's clearly Etienne who more closely resembles Irving. Not just that, but Etienne has the speed to break even bigger runs than Irving might have in the same situation. The problem for this comparison pops up when you look at the Jacksonville offensive line, which is patchy at best. The Jaguars will need to get their trenches in order, and Etienne will need to stay healthy after playing through a hamstring tweak for an unspecified number of weeks in 2024. There's also some chance Coen becomes enamored with rookie fourth-round pick Bhayshul Tuten, whose 4.32 40 time makes him one of the few RBs in the league who is clearly faster than Etienne.

Top suitors include Chiefs, Broncos
Etienne is expected to garner interest from Kansas City and Denver in free agency, according to Jeremy Fowler of ESPN.com.
ANALYSIS
Etienne's three-down skill set appeals to the pair of AFC West contenders. He's expected to contend for the highest salary among free-agent running backs with Kenneth Walker, who may be a better pure runner than Etienne but isn't as reliable as a blocker and pass catcher. Fowler expects both running backs to get close to $12 million per year.
